Output 21fa1ae04fd98e4df5e6b8dfc24c3e3a1935888e43539294fd9bd994264c6f86:0

value
17805
script pubkey
OP_0 OP_PUSHBYTES_20 ad5dce8b4b4a6296719a28d58fc15602b2eeb1e5
address
bc1q44wuaz6tff3fvuv69r2cls2kq2ewav09a5c607
transaction
21fa1ae04fd98e4df5e6b8dfc24c3e3a1935888e43539294fd9bd994264c6f86
spent
true